Bootmod3

N55 electronic wastegate (EWG):
Stage 1 91 ocatne: 25%HP / 28%TQ
Stage 1 93 octane: 27%HP / 30%TQ
Stage 2 91 octane: 31%HP / 34%TQ
Stage 2 93 octane: 33%HP / 36%TQ


Bootmod3 of the shelf maps provides more power than MHD
